For the first time in the arena

“For the first time in the arena” - Soviet hand-drawn cartoon of 1961 from Soyuzmultfilm studio . The directors Vladimir Pekar and Vladimir Popov created a fairy tale about a circus elephant.

Story

The baby elephant Timka dreamed of becoming a circus artist, so he made his way to a rehearsal in the circus. When Timka returned the ball lost by the juggler to the arena, the Bear, an old circus artist, drew attention to him. The bear suggested the elephant try to juggle the ball. Timka tried, but then could not resist and fell on the instruments of the couplets (dog and monkey), which were loudly outraged. The bear comforted the elephant with the words: to become an artist, you have to work day and night. Timka rehearsed for a long time and by the beginning of the tour he mastered juggling, balancing on a ball. The couplets failed miserably, but Timka successfully performed, and the audience applauded the young talent for a long time.

Review Review

Baker and Popov have tried themselves in directing since the beginning of the 60s. They put on several paintings that were included in the "multitek" kids and still do not leave the television screens. Among them, “For the First Time in the Arena” (1961), is actually the directorial debut, the dilogy about the Umka bear cub (1969–1970), and the touching drama “Return Rex” (1975).

- Natalia Venzher “Our cartoons” [1]
